Jasper and his family enjoy living in the Amazon jungle. It's full of family, friends, and adventures. Knowing their sister, Piper, will soon learn how to fly, will only add to the fun this family of birds will embark on. The brothers, Jasper and Willie, are growing up in this wonderland of colors, sounds, and smells. They will need to rely on each other and friends as a strange new animal turns into a new buddy, while another can disrupt their lives forever. While new challenges are always popping up, nothing can prepare Jasper and his friends for what is about to happen - something unexpected that will change everything.

Sharon C. Williams is a native of New England raised in Northern Maine. She lives in North Carolina with her husband and son. She is also owned by a flock of birds

Sharon has a B. S. degree in Chemistry. She loves to read, sketch, take pictures, walk, exercise, go to the movies, and listen to music. She is a budding bird watcher, and knits on the side. She is a huge sports fan of baseball, basketball, hockey, and football. She is also a shutterbug and is always looking for the next big shot.

Sharon tends to write by long hand as the flow works better for her this way. Her bookshelf consists of works written by Stephen King, Agatha Christie, Bentley Little, and James Patterson. The best advice she has ever received about writing was to write about what you know. Her first thought was, “Yeah right,” but it really is that easy. A writer just needs to know a little tidbit to turn it into a short story, and soon enough, there's a book.

Two of her short stories were published in the anthology, Cassandra's Roadhouse, and two in the Dragons in the Attic anthology, which was written by her writing group, The Wonder Chicks. Her children's chapter book, Jasper, Amazon Parrot: A Rainforest Adventure, and Jasper: Amazon Friends and Family, was released by Fountain Blue Publishing in 2013 and 2015. Volume three, "Jasper, Amazon Parrot: The Perils of The Jungle", was released in November of 2019. Her comedy novel about her war with her backyard squirrels, Squirrel Mafia, was also released in the spring of 2015. Her latest book, “Everyday Musings” which is a collection of short stories and poems was released Sept. 30th, 2016

As of 2016 Sharon has started an author'scoaching and beta reading service.

The Perils of the Jungle is the third book in the Jasper - Amazon Parrot series written by Sharon C. Williams. In this fun and educational story, a family of parrots find themselves in danger from people who want to cut down trees in the jungle. Jasper and his brother seek out their friends to find help, only to discover the concern is even bigger. What will they do?

Williams creates memorable characters who are excellent animals for children to identify with... from a sloth to monkeys, and a frog to a jaguar... the parrots meet friends and foes in this helpful chapter book. It's important for kids to learn the positives and negatives in the world, and the author handles it with ease and aplomb. She builds suspense and fear, but there is also a lighthearted humor to the family dynamics between Jasper and his mother and siblings. We also learn what happened to the father in this family, and it's a big sad.

Piper was a fun new addition, and I enjoyed seeing Charlie, the spider monkey again. He makes the kids seem like a rowdy and lovable bunch of jungle dwellers, rounding out the cast to have a strong sense of difference and similarity. This helps kids learn how to relate to one another, as well as when to take risks and how to be careful when you don't know what is lurking in the larger space around you.

I hope the author continues writing more tales, helping show us what we can learn from books and animals... and I'd love to see this being read to a group in a library setting. More pictures too, please. The covers are adorable and I want to see images of all the animals. Kudos to a job well done!

Ah, it was true the forest never slept. And this time the stakes were raised, and Jasper had his family had to take a few life changing decisions.

My third book by author Sharon C. Williams, the story had tension coursing through it. I could feel the fear the birds felt. Now that they had a tiny sister, Piper, the boys Jasper and Willie knew that they had a new responsibility toward their family. Their mum Sally was as sweet as ever.

The story dealt with a few harsh realities, I got to know the animals' POV. The author did a brilliant job explaining how forests were homes to myriad of creatures, big and small. A different friend and a known enemy soon made their appearance to increase the pace of the story

Life lessons continued on, friendships remained firm. The book showed how families and friends ought to help each other. The author was brilliant in driving home a few important facts of life. So important for our kids to learn.

The story did end on a high note, leaving me with only one thought - What was next for Jasper and his family? So I got to wait until the author writes the fourth book.

A brilliant series.
